About this House

Elegant & updated stately Colonial with wood floors throughout. Living room with fireplace, separate dining room, renovated kitchen with stainless steel and family room with exit to the patio. 2nd floor has 3 bedrooms, 2 full baths. Lower level with tiled family room, bedroom, 2 bathrooms and office. Backyard with patio. 2 car garage. Available September 5th. No smokers. Close to Metro & Tenley
4726 36th St NW, Washington, DC 20008 is a 4 bedroom, 4 bathroom, 1,782 sqft single-family home in Wakefield, built in 1939. It last sold for $910,000 on Jul 15, 2008. More recently, it was listed as a rental in September 2018 with an asking price of $4,500 per month. That rental listing was removed on September 22, 2018. This property is not currently displayed as for sale or rent on Trulia. The Trulia Estimate is $1,663,100, with a rent estimate of $6,275/month.
